Thanx. How can I get to Tel Aviv using public transportation and how and where should I rent bikes and bike ride?
Back to top

chanchy123




 
 
    
 

Post Wed, Jan 30 2019, 11:57 am
Assuming you are in Jerusalem take the bus (train seems to be out of order).
The bus runs regularly from the central bus station. Takes about 40 mins when it's not rush hour.
Not sure about the bikes but it's supposed to be great weather, go to the Yaffo boardwalk and you can walk north to TA. I think you can rent bikes on the boardwalk. Another recommended place I'd the TA harbor. Tons of restaurants too.

Can I get to the Yaffo boardwalk , walk to the north to TA , rent bikes on the boardwalk, and Tel Aviv harbor, if I take the 480 to Tel Aviv tzafon Tel Aviv port?
Back to top

kakky




 
 
    
 

Post Thu, Jan 31 2019, 4:42 am
take the 480 bus. you can rent bikes near the bus station and ride to where you want. it can be hard to ride through the city but along the board walk which goes from yafo to TA post it is perfect. you can also take a bus to the boardwalk and get bikes there.
you can return the bikes at any where.
